Blocking Calls
To block incoming calls to a BlackBerry smartphone, create a new
IT Policy and then edit the Firewall policy group:
Select Restrict Incoming Cellular Calls.
Enter the number you want to block.
For example: +353##########r;
An r and a semicolon must occur at the end of the phone number,
or the IT policy will allow the phone number listed and block
the rest of the phone numbers from calling
Requirements:
BlackBerry® Device Software version 4.3 to 4.7. BlackBerry®
Enterprise Server version 4.1 SP6 for Microsoft® Exchange
